Output 658a9d42af8517b527761dbbf3539646e275445224f0ff6d515c0f0b25eb9d97:3

value
740297196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1113b092bf548eab6fa2933bf3c453d34d7edb OP_EQUAL
address
38iWQqe3i56NUcgk3EzJTjcDBPE1PR12v6
transaction
658a9d42af8517b527761dbbf3539646e275445224f0ff6d515c0f0b25eb9d97
confirmations
368360
spent
true